Hi Ceiron Do you think you might have loosened a tooth during play? If so there isn't much you can do.

Oscar isn't young is he, as dogs get older they can get gum disease which can cause the teeth to bleed easily. Regular brushing the teeth with a soft brush and feeding raw carrots to clean the teeth can help with this.
